Gas Guzzlers Extreme PC Game Full version


Review:
Gas Guzzlers Extreme, for no sensible reason, reminds me of a racing game I thoroughly enjoyed and yet have never heard a single other human mention: Beetle Crazy Cup. It came out in 2000, from Infrogrames as was, by the entirely unknown Xpiral. It was a VW-licensed game that I gave it 85% in PC Gamer back then, and I don’t think a single person bought it. I bring this up, because I’m struggling to find too many interesting things to say about Gas Guzzlers Extreme.


That’s not to say it’s a disaster. It’s incredibly clumsy, but the issue here is that it’s just a touch bland. It’s, well, a driving game with shooting in it. It’s Mario Kart with proper cars, and utterly without the intuitive delivery. Have I enjoyed my brief go? A bit. I haven’t hated it. I’ve driven around a few tracks, done well, done badly, shot at other cars and been shot at. And, it all feels awfully familiar.


There’s a definite desire to go big, but unfortunately little actual delivery. So while it seems to think it’s delivering big explosions and violence, it’s all rather tempered and ordinary, the real pleasure of an anarchic driving game buried in a confusion of obscurity. Everything is just so incredibly vague, from whether you’ve clipped a floating bonus item to pick it up to what bonus you currently have to whether you’ve deployed it. The Arcade mode offers generous cornering and liberal use of handbrakes, and that’s my sort of racing, but all the other cars seem to be having a lot more fun than me. I can see the mines they’ve dropped – I’ve no idea if I’ve ever dropped mine.

There’s a garage, cars to be bought and augmented with won money, exactly as you’d expect. You begin with a Reliant Robin, then move onto a Beetle – you get the idea there. But you can attach weapons, boost engines, etc, and then take part in the heavily rubber-banded racing that’s a mad cluster of short-cuts and frustration as other drivers crash into you. That’s an issue solved by jumping online, of course, where such actions feel far more fair when done at you by another human. Although that’s a bit tricky here – at the time of writing there were a total of seven people playing, and the game wouldn’t let me join the one populated race. Which is actually a shame, as the deathmatch mode against the AI is quite fun. It has potential online.

However, I really wasn’t too impressed with a new game in late 2013 turning Win 7 down to Basic mode, nor refusing to launch until I’d set my desktop resolution to 1024×768.

Creating a Pentomino game using AS3 Part 38

Today we will add the ability to browse through the solutions.

Firstly declare a new variable - currentSol. Set its value to 0 by default. This variable represents the id of the solution that is currently displayed.

private var currentSol:int = 0;

Open the project in Flash and go to fifth frame (the solutions screen). Add two buttons shaped like arrows with ids btn_prev and btn_next. Add a dynamic text field with id tSol, it will display which solutions is currently is shown.

Go to level_solver.as again and in the solve() function add CLICK event listeners for btn_prev and btn_next. Set handlers to goPrev and goNext functions:

btn_prev.addEventListener(MouseEvent.CLICK, goPrev);
btn_next.addEventListener(MouseEvent.CLICK, goNext);

The functions decrease/increase currentSol values and call updateCurrentInfo() function.

private function goPrev(evt:MouseEvent):void {
currentSol--;
updateCurrentInfo();
}

private function goNext(evt:MouseEvent):void {
currentSol++;
updateCurrentInfo();
}

The same function is called in nextCycle():

private function nextCycle():void {
cycleNum++;
updateCurrentInfo();
if (cycleNum == givenShapes.length) {
removeEventListener(Event.ENTER_FRAME, onFrame);
// display info
tInfo.text = Finished solving " + levelName + "
Attempts: + attempts + "
Solutions: " + solutions.length;
}
}

The function updates what is displayed in the tSol text field, disables/enables arrow buttons when needed, draws the preview image:

private function updateCurrentInfo():void {
var sol:int = (solutions.length > 0)?(currentSol + 1):(0);
tSol.text = sol + "/" + solutions.length;
if (sol <= 1) {
btn_prev.alpha = 0.5;
btn_prev.mouseEnabled = false;
}else {
btn_prev.alpha = 1;
btn_prev.mouseEnabled = true;
}
if (sol == solutions.length) {
btn_next.alpha = 0.5;
btn_next.mouseEnabled = false;
}else {
btn_next.alpha = 1;
btn_next.mouseEnabled = true;
}
if (solutions.length > 0) drawPreview(levelPreview, solutions[currentSol]);
}

Update the drawPreview() function so that cells are colored depending on the shape type:

private function drawPreview(levelPreview:MovieClip, mapGrid:Array):void {
var columns:int = mapGrid[0].length;
var rows:int = mapGrid.length;
var frameWidth:int = levelPreview.width;
var frameHeight:int = levelPreview.height;
var padding:int = 5;
var fitWidth:int = levelPreview.width - (padding * 2);
var fitHeight:int = levelPreview.height - (padding * 2);
var gridStartX:int;
var gridStartY:int;

// calculate width of a cell:
var gridCellWidth:int = Math.round(fitWidth / columns);

var width:int = columns * gridCellWidth;
var height:int = rows * gridCellWidth;

// calculate side margin
gridStartX = (frameWidth - width) / 2;

if (height < fitHeight) {
gridStartY = (fitHeight - height) / 2;
}
if (height >= fitHeight) {
gridCellWidth = Math.round(fitHeight / rows);
height = rows * gridCellWidth;
width = columns * gridCellWidth;
gridStartY = (frameHeight - height) / 2;
gridStartX = (frameWidth - width) / 2;
}

// draw map
levelPreview.shape.x = gridStartX;
levelPreview.shape.y = gridStartY;
levelPreview.shape.graphics.clear();
var i:int;
var u:int;

for (i = 0; i < rows; i++) {
for (u = 0; u < columns; u++) {
if (mapGrid[i][u] == 1) drawCell(u, i, 0xffffff, 1, 0x999999, gridCellWidth, levelPreview.shape);
if (mapGrid[i][u] == 2) drawCell(u, i, 0xff66cc, 1, 0x000000, gridCellWidth, levelPreview.shape);
if (mapGrid[i][u] == 3) drawCell(u, i, 0x00FF66, 1, 0x000000, gridCellWidth, levelPreview.shape);
if (mapGrid[i][u] == 4) drawCell(u, i, 0x99ff00, 1, 0x000000, gridCellWidth, levelPreview.shape);
if (mapGrid[i][u] == 5) drawCell(u, i, 0x00ccff, 1, 0x000000, gridCellWidth, levelPreview.shape);
if (mapGrid[i][u] == 6) drawCell(u, i, 0xffcc66, 1, 0x000000, gridCellWidth, levelPreview.shape);
if (mapGrid[i][u] == 7) drawCell(u, i, 0x66cc33, 1, 0x000000, gridCellWidth, levelPreview.shape);
if (mapGrid[i][u] == 8) drawCell(u, i, 0x9900ff, 1, 0x000000, gridCellWidth, levelPreview.shape);
if (mapGrid[i][u] == 9) drawCell(u, i, 0xff5858, 1, 0x000000, gridCellWidth, levelPreview.shape);
if (mapGrid[i][u] == 10) drawCell(u, i, 0xff6600, 1, 0x000000, gridCellWidth, levelPreview.shape);
if (mapGrid[i][u] == 11) drawCell(u, i, 0x00ffff, 1, 0x000000, gridCellWidth, levelPreview.shape);
if (mapGrid[i][u] == 12) drawCell(u, i, 0xff6b20, 1, 0x000000, gridCellWidth, levelPreview.shape);
if (mapGrid[i][u] == 13) drawCell(u, i, 0xffff66, 1, 0x000000, gridCellWidth, levelPreview.shape);
}
}
}

Now we can browse through the solutions!

Creating a Pentomino game using AS3 Part 9

Today well improve our shape placing code, as well as make all shapes available for placing.

First of all, well create a function that draws a preview of where the shape will be placed exactly. We need to declare a new Sprite object for this - canPutShape:

private var canPutShape:Sprite = new Sprite();

And add it to the stage after creating the grid:

// can put shape
addChild(canPutShape);
canPutShape.x = gridStartX;
canPutShape.y = gridStartY;

The function uses some of the already used code in the script, slightly modified. We simply loop through the currentValues and draw each cell:

private function drawCanPut():void {
canPutShape.graphics.clear();
var mousePos:Point = new Point(Math.floor((mouseX - gridStartX) / gridCellWidth), Math.floor((mouseY - gridStartY) / gridCellWidth));
for (var i:int = 0; i < currentValues.length; i++) {
var cellX:int = (currentValues[i][0] + mousePos.x) * gridCellWidth;
var cellY:int = (currentValues[i][1] + mousePos.y) * gridCellWidth;
canPutShape.graphics.beginFill(0x00ff00, 0.1);
canPutShape.graphics.drawRect(cellX, cellY, gridCellWidth, gridCellWidth);
}
}

Now go to mouseMove() and instead of the selectedShape if statement call a function called checkPut():

private function mouseMove(evt:MouseEvent):void {
cursor.x = mouseX;
cursor.y = mouseY;
checkPut();
}

The functions code is the same, but has a few modifications. We check if canPutHere is tru or false and set the cursors alpha to represent whether its possible or not to place the selected shape here. We also clear canPutShapes graphics if canPutHere is false.

private function checkPut():void {
if (selectedShape > 0) {
var mousePos:Point = new Point(Math.floor((mouseX - gridStartX) / gridCellWidth), Math.floor((mouseY - gridStartY) / gridCellWidth));
canPutHere = true;
updateCurrentValues();
for (var i:int = 0; i < currentValues.length; i++) {
var cellX:int = currentValues[i][0] + mousePos.x;
var cellY:int = currentValues[i][1] + mousePos.y;
if (cellX < 0 || cellY < 0 || cellX >= mapGrid[0].length || cellY >= mapGrid.length || mapGrid[cellY][cellX]!=1) {
canPutHere = false;
}
}
if (canPutHere) {
cursor.alpha = 0.8;
}
if (!canPutHere) {
canPutShape.graphics.clear();
cursor.alpha = 0.4;
}
}
}

Where is drawCanPut() called if not in checkPut(), you ask? Thats in updateCurrentValues(), but only after weve added a few modifications to the code inside updateCurrentValues(). These bugs were found after I implemented the "shadow" feature thats drawn by drawCanPut(), and you can see the updated code below:

private function updateCurrentValues():void {
currentValues = clone(shapeValues[selectedShape-1]);
for (var i:int = 0; i < 5; i++) {
if (cursor.rotation == 90) {
currentValues[i].reverse();
currentValues[i][0] *= -1;
}
if (cursor.rotation == 180 || cursor.rotation == -180) {
currentValues[i][0] *= -1;
currentValues[i][1] *= -1;
}
if (cursor.rotation == -90) {
currentValues[i].reverse();
currentValues[i][1] *= -1;
}
if (cursor.scaleX < 0 && (cursor.rotation != -90 || cursor.rotation != 90)) {
currentValues[i][0] *= -1;
}
if (cursor.scaleX < 0 && (cursor.rotation == -90 || cursor.rotation == 90)) {
currentValues[i][0] *= -1;
currentValues[i][1] *= -1;
}
}
drawCanPut();
}

Call checkPut() instead of updateCurrentValues() in mouseWheel() and keyDown():

private function mouseWheel(evt:MouseEvent):void {
if (evt.delta > 0) cursor.rotation += 90;
if (evt.delta < 0) cursor.rotation -= 90;
if (selectedShape > 0) checkPut();
}

private function keyDown(evt:KeyboardEvent):void {
if (evt.keyCode == 68) cursor.rotation += 90;
if (evt.keyCode == 65) cursor.rotation -= 90;
if (evt.keyCode == 32) cursor.scaleX *= -1;
if (selectedShape > 0) checkPut();
}

Now we can update the shapeValues() array. Simply add each shape cells relative coordinates:

shapeValues = [
[[0, 0], [0, 1], [0, 2], [0, -1], [0, -2]],
[[0, 0], [0, -1], [0, 1], [1, 0], [1, -1]],
[[0, 0], [0, 1], [0, 2], [0, -1], [ -1, -1]],
[[0, 0], [0, 1], [0, -1], [ -1, 0], [1, -1]],
[[0, 0], [ -1, 0], [ -2, 0], [0, -1], [1, -1]],
[[0, 0], [0, 1], [0, -1], [1, -1], [ -1, -1]],
[[0, 0], [1, 0], [ -1, 0], [1, -1], [ -1, -1]],
[[0, 0], [ -1, 0], [ -2, 0], [0, -1], [0, -2]],
[[0, 0], [0, 1], [ -1, 1], [1, 0], [1, -1]],
[[0, 0], [0, 1], [0, -1], [1, 0], [ -1, 0]],
[[0, 0], [ -1, 0], [ -2, 0], [1, 0], [0, -1]],
[[0, 0], [0, 1], [1, 1], [0, -1], [-1, -1]]
];

Creating a Pentomino game using AS3 Part 8

In this part we will add the ability to place rotated shape on the grid.

In the previous tutorials we used internal (temporary) variable inside several functions named currentValues. Lets make this a private variable available in all functions:

private var currentValues:Array = [];

So in mouseMove(), instead of setting value to this variable we call updateCurrentValues():

private function mouseMove(evt:MouseEvent):void {
cursor.x = mouseX;
cursor.y = mouseY;
if (selectedShape > 0) {
var mousePos:Point = new Point(Math.floor((mouseX - gridStartX) / gridCellWidth), Math.floor((mouseY - gridStartY) / gridCellWidth));
canPutHere = true;
updateCurrentValues();
for (var i:int = 0; i < currentValues.length; i++) {
var cellX:int = currentValues[i][0] + mousePos.x;
var cellY:int = currentValues[i][1] + mousePos.y;
if (cellX < 0 || cellY < 0 || cellX >= mapGrid[0].length || cellY >= mapGrid.length || mapGrid[cellY][cellX]!=1) {
canPutHere = false;
}
}
}
}

Call the same function in mouseWheel and keyDown if there is a shape thats selected:

private function mouseWheel(evt:MouseEvent):void {
if (evt.delta > 0) cursor.rotation += 90;
if (evt.delta < 0) cursor.rotation -= 90;
if (selectedShape > 0) updateCurrentValues();
}

private function keyDown(evt:KeyboardEvent):void {
if (evt.keyCode == 68) cursor.rotation += 90;
if (evt.keyCode == 65) cursor.rotation -= 90;
if (evt.keyCode == 32) cursor.scaleX *= -1;
if (selectedShape > 0) updateCurrentValues();
}

Go to mouseUp() and add a line that sets the new shapes rotation to cursor.rotation:

private function mouseUp(evt:MouseEvent):void {
stopDragShape();
if (selectedShape > 0) {
if (!canPutHere) {
availableShapes[selectedShape-1]++;
shapeButtons[selectedShape-1].count.text = availableShapes[selectedShape-1];
selectedShape = 0;
}
if (canPutHere) {
var mousePos:Point = new Point(Math.floor((mouseX - gridStartX) / gridCellWidth), Math.floor((mouseY - gridStartY) / gridCellWidth));
var newShape:MovieClip = new game_shape();
addChild(newShape);
newShape.x = gridStartX + (mousePos.x+1) * gridCellWidth - gridCellWidth / 2;
newShape.y = gridStartY + (mousePos.y + 1) * gridCellWidth - gridCellWidth / 2;
newShape.rotation = cursor.rotation;
newShape.scaleX = cursor.scaleX;
newShape.scaleY = cursor.scaleY;
newShape.gotoAndStop(selectedShape);
for (var i:int = 0; i < currentValues.length; i++) {
var cellX:int = currentValues[i][0] + mousePos.x;
var cellY:int = currentValues[i][1] + mousePos.y;
mapGrid[cellY][cellX] = 2;
}
cursor.parent.setChildIndex(cursor, cursor.parent.numChildren - 1);
selectedShape = 0;
}
}
}

Now create a new function called clone(). This will be used to clone an array with arrays inside of it properly:

private function clone(source:Object):*{
var myBA:ByteArray = new ByteArray();
myBA.writeObject(source);
myBA.position = 0;
return(myBA.readObject());
}

Add updateCurrentValues() function. Here in the first line we clone the respective element in shapeValues and apply that value to currentValues.

Then we loop through all the 5 elemenst of it, and go through a few if statements to modify the values. If cursors rotation is 0, we dont need to change anything, since the values in currentValues apply here. If the shape has rotation 90, we need to reverse the values of each element (x becomes y and y becomes x). If the rotation is 180 or -180, we inverse the values by multiplying them by -1. If the rotation is -90, inverse and reverse the values. If scaleX of cursor is less than 0, inverse the X values:

private function updateCurrentValues():void {
currentValues = clone(shapeValues[selectedShape-1]);
for (var i:int = 0; i < 5; i++) {
if (cursor.rotation == 90) currentValues[i].reverse();
if (cursor.rotation == 180 || cursor.rotation == -180) {
currentValues[i][0] *= -1;
currentValues[i][1] *= -1;
}
if (cursor.rotation == -90) {
currentValues[i].reverse();
currentValues[i][0] *= -1;
currentValues[i][1] *= -1;
}
if (cursor.scaleX < 0) {
currentValues[i][0] *= -1;
}
}
}

Now we can drag, rotate, and drop the first shape properly.
